Understanding Titan and Its Market Position
Titan Company Limited, founded in 1984, is a leading lifestyle retailer in India primarily recognized for its jewelry, watches, and eyewear products.
Tanishq, Fastrack, and Titan Watches are some of Titan’s subsidiary brands, which make it a household name and nifty 50 stocks in the Indian market.
With a market capitalization of approximately ₹293,578 crores as of Dec 2024, Titan’s strong brand equity and extensive distribution networks position it favorably to capitalize on seasonal demand peaks. This is true, especially for the festive season when consumer spending typically surges.
Impact of the Festive Season on Titan Stocks
For Titan, the festive season, which includes significant festivals such as Diwali, Dussehra, and multiple weddings, is an important period. Cultural practices and gifting traditions increase consumer spending on gold, jewelry, and premium watches. The impact of the festive season on Titan share price can be seen in the following:
Sales Growth during Festivities
During the festive season, Titan has experienced an impressive boost in their sales numbers. During the festive season, the company has witnessed a 27% increase in sales of their watches and their overall sales grew by 50% due to the consumers’ strong demand for premium products.
Consumer Insights
During the festive season, Titan benefits from enhanced consumer sentiment and optimism. Consumers are willing to spend more during Dhanteras and Diwali, boosting revenue forecasts.
For example, Titan reported a 24% year-over-year growth in its total revenue, and Titan’s jewelry segment alone recorded a revenue increase of 26% in Q2 2025, fueled by festive and wedding demand spikes. This hike was attributed to a 12% rise in buyer growth, due to the strong demand for gold jewelry and coins/bullion.
Key factors to consider about Cyclical investing in Titan
Understanding the cyclical trends in Titan’s stock performance due to festive seasons provides valuable insights into potential investment strategies.
Stock Price Fluctuation
Titan’s share price tends to fluctuate around significant festive periods. For example, in early 2024, the stock declined approximately 17% due to weak Q2 earnings before the festive season commenced, yet investors were optimistic about a rebound fueled by anticipated sales growth due to the upcoming festive season.
Investment Timing
Investors usually consider initiating positions before the start of festive seasons, harnessing expected sales spikes that often translate into positive stock performance. Conversely, post-festive periods see a decline as profit-taking occurs.
Cyclical Investing Strategy
A cyclical investment approach for Titan could involve buying shares before key festive dates and holding them long enough for potential price appreciation driven by sales performance. This approach, coupled with periodic monitoring of quarterly earnings reports and consumer trends, can help investors strategize their entry and exit points effectively.
